Now lets get into the craft!


What you need for the first craft: fine glitter (color of your choice - I chose gold and silver), Mod Podge,  pinecones and/or pumpkins. 

First, follow the instructions on the Mod Podge bottle and pour some on a paper plate. Then take your Mod Podge and dab it on your object where you would like it. Next you are going to drizzle the glitter over the Mod Podge. Once you are all done leave it to dry for a few hours. Tip: I suggest working in sections. Also, I suggest covering your surface by using a paper plater underneath to collect the glitter and reuse.






















The next DIY is the simplest of them all. What you will need is leaves and sparkle Mod Podge. Follow the instructions on the bottle  and pour on a paper plate. Paint the leaves with the sparkled Mod Podge. Then leave to dry. Your result should be a shiny leaf with a sparkle touch.
